Default Received hoodies from Independent Trading Co.

OK, as I mentioned in my previous thread, I just received the hoodies from Independent Trading Co.

I ordered Men's Zip Up Hoodies, size L, in black, heather grey, charcoal grey and brown.

Great quality! Great stitching. Not heavyweight, it seems as though they are medium weight hoodies. I believe the hoodies with the kangaroo pockets are heavyweight.

I like them alot.

Here is their link:
www.independenttradingco.com

Rodney, I think you should look into their other hoodies in stock. They are based in Orange County, CA, in San Clemente.
